Everton Fans Deserve Champions League. Everton Football Club Deserve Championship.

This is not something i'm writing as a reactionary piece after a yard dog striker slotted the winner for Leicester against us in the 94th. This is something i've thought for a good while now. The Foxes' winner has just...

